Solution Overview
Problem
Virtual server instance provisioning in complex infrastructures is challenging due to numerous dependencies, making it difficult to identify and resolve provisioning failures effectively.
Innovation Solution
A method and system for dynamic resource provisioning that classify requests for virtual server instances, predict dependent resources, generate a provisioning plan with timing and configuration information, and allocate hardware resources accordingly, while adapting to resource failures by reallocating resources.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Adaptability or versatility
If virtual server instances are provisioned in a complex infrastructure with many dependencies, then the system can provide comprehensive computing resources and functionality, but it becomes difficult to identify and resolve provisioning failures
Solution Approach 1:
The patent applies preliminary action by generating a provisioning plan before actual resource allocation. This plan includes timing and configuration information for all dependent resources, allowing the system to predict and prepare for potential failures before they occur, making it easier to identify and resolve issues during provisioning
Solution Approach 2:
The patent introduces a provisioning plan as an intermediary between the provisioning request and actual resource allocation. This intermediary layer tracks and manages all dependencies, serving as a mediator that helps identify which specific resource caused a provisioning failure without requiring direct analysis of the complex infrastructure
2Productivity
If virtual server instances are provisioned quickly and flexibly, then customer needs can be met rapidly, but ensuring consistent provisioning across all dependencies becomes more challenging
Solution Approach 1:
The system performs preliminary classification of provisioning requests and generates complete provisioning plans before execution. This advance preparation ensures that all dependencies are identified and configured correctly, maintaining consistency while enabling rapid provisioning when the plan is executed
Solution Approach 2:
The patent implements dynamic provisioning by allowing the system to adapt the provisioning plan based on real-time resource availability and conditions. The system can adjust timing and configuration information while maintaining consistency across all dependencies, balancing speed with precision

AI summary
Methods and systems for provisioning resources includes classifying a request for a virtual server instance (VSI) according to resources specified in the request. Dependent resources that the VSI will use are predicted based on the specified resources. A provisioning plan is generated, including timing and configuration information, based on the specified resources and the dependent resources. Resources for the VSI are provisioned according to the provisioning plan, including allocating hardware resources on a computing system.
